Output 270e559d4a8ee1663ead33e840dc93cafede9b3bbb477c8b92ee1c52abca45c5:2

value
37000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ff0e37aa7c41e599d458b94df35a5528caa0d69a OP_EQUAL
address
3QwdGJhMvWLuUXNaoVbNEHQXdGQk8KFCcH
transaction
270e559d4a8ee1663ead33e840dc93cafede9b3bbb477c8b92ee1c52abca45c5
confirmations
246556
spent
true